c# OPC 连接 远程服务器问题 点击:1719 | 回复:2



numbermahao

    
  • 精华:0帖
  • 求助:1帖
  • 帖子:1帖 | 0回
  • 年度积分:0
  • 历史总积分:35
  • 注册:2015年5月21日
发表于:2015-06-25 11:21:02
楼主

 public bool Connect(string progID, string serverName)
        {
            try
            {
                Type typeofOPCserver = Type.GetTypeFromProgID(progID, serverName);

                OPCserverObj = Activator.CreateInstance(typeofOPCserver);
                ifServer = (IOPCServer)OPCserverObj;
                // connect all interfaces
                ifCommon = (IOPCCommon)OPCserverObj;
                ifBrowse = (IOPCBrowseServerAddressSpace)ifServer;
                ifItmProps = (IOPCItemProperties)ifServer;
                cpointcontainer = (IConnectionPointContainer)OPCserverObj;
         
                isConnect = true;
                return true;
            }
            catch(Exception ex)
            {
                isConnect = false
            }
        }


Type typeofOPCserver = Type.GetTypeFromProgID(progID, serverName);这行代码无法获取远程OPC服务器类型,神马原因啊,如何处理啊啊,谢谢各位大侠了!!!(客户端OPC环境配置没有问题)




yuyu

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 1回
  • 年度积分:0
  • 历史总积分:1
  • 注册:2016年6月25日
发表于:2016-06-25 11:05:07
1楼

把变量一起贴出来呀!!!!!!

007zhouwu

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 2回
  • 年度积分:0
  • 历史总积分:6
  • 注册:2013年2月28日
发表于:2016-07-07 11:00:44
2楼

DCOM设置问题,找找资料设置一下服务器的DCOM


热门招聘
相关主题

官方公众号

智造工程师